    3 errors to spot..
    the ht6 pump is the old version. No baked silicon coating...rounded front cap. This means the back cap will leak.. no cure until the latest version.
    the aftermarket computer takes the mysteriously perfect GM 4 wire alternator control away... a full LED swap helps.
    and it still has the errored cab mounts. (Energy suspension fixes that cheaply) to align bed to cab better.
